Jeff Bronson jumped out to an early lead in the Modified feature. Mike
Colsten started deep in the field and he steadily started to pick off
positions one by one. Within 14 laps, Colsten was on Bronson=92s rear bumper.
Colsten worked on Bronson, outside and inside
before blasting past him in the outside groove with only 4 laps to go.
Colsten pulled away from Bronson and won his second feature of the season.
Bronson came home second with Butch Tittle third, Bill Huff in Fourth and
Brian Weaver rounded out the top
five.
Jim Sherman finally found some luck. He has had a string of bad breaks
within the last couple of weeks. He led the entire Late Model feature for
his first victory of the season.
Behind him, the other Late Model driers were battling three and even four
wide out of the turns. At the end, Jeremy Stone came home in second
followed by Bill Marvin,
Gene Sharpsteen, and Alan Coy.
The Street Stock feature was filled with family action. Dan Vauter and
his father Dick filled the front row. Dick pulled out to an early lead,
leading every lap and winning his first feature of the season. Dan feel
back through the field and finished 11th. Joe Domiano had his best ever
finish, coming home in second place and Tracy Gregory cam
home in third. Rich Keehle and Chris Piasecki rounded out the top five.

In addition to the regular five classes at Penn Can the Legends cars were
in action as well. Ray Scigowsky won his first ever feature at Penn Can.
He grabbed the lead from Tim Henry on lap 2 and drove the victory. He was
followed by Brian Levan who made his way around Jim Baker in the late stages
of the race.
